Preparation of the inoculum :
The inoculum was washed, brought to a concentration of 5 g/I dry substance and aerated for 24 hours .
50 ml were added to a total volume of 250 ml to obtain a concentration of 1 g/I dry substance in the test .

No stock solution for the test substance was prepared, since the test substance was added in appropriate amounts to each of the proposed test concentrations.
For the reference substance, a stock solution of 500 mg/L was prepared.
